Plant Assets
Fixed assets that are tangible in nature, such as buildings and machinery, used in the operations of a business and expected to be useful for many years.
Profit Margin
A measure of a company's profitability, typically defined as net income divided by revenue, and expressed as a percentage.
Investment Turnover
A component of the rate of return on investment, computed as the ratio of sales to invested assets.
Return on Investment
A measure used to evaluate the efficiency of an investment, calculated by dividing the profit gained on an investment by the cost of the investment.
